C语言课程设计案例学生信息管理.pptVIP

  • 4
  • 0
  • 约8.08千字
  • 约 30页
  • 2018-02-05 发布于浙江
  • 举报
C语言课程设计案例学生信息管理

C语言课程设计 C语言课程设计 学生信息管理 一、功能要求 能对学生的学号、姓名、性别、出生日期、所学专业、所在班级信息进行管理 管理功能包括添加学生信息、查询学生信息、修改学生信息、删除学生信息、恢复删除信息 二、概要设计 三、详细设计 学生信息: 删除标志 字符 ‘*’为已删除标志 学号 长整数 姓名 字符串 最长10个字符 性别 字符 男-M,女-F 出生日期 4位年份,2位月份,2位日 所学专业 字符串 最长20个字符 所在班级 字符串 最长10个字符 平均成绩 实数 两位小数 数据文件: 1.文件名:“Student.dat” 2.文件格式:二进制随机文件,每个学生一条记录。 主菜单: 1.添加学生信息 2.查询学生信息 3.修改学生信息 4.删除学生信息 5.恢复删除信息 0.退出 处理函数: 1.添加学生信息 AddStuden() (1)以“添加方式”打开学生数据文件“Student.dat” (2)输入一个学生的有关信息 (3)将输入的学生信息写入“Student.dat”文件 (4)继续添加?(y/n),“y”返回(2),否则关闭文件,返回主菜单。 处理函数: 2.查询学生信息 QueryStuden() (1)以“只读方式”打开学生数据文件“Student.dat” (2

文档评论(0)

1亿VIP精品文档

相关文档